Actually, the USD has lost its value, it's just that because everything is always compared to the USD so that it makes USD has not lost anything but actually it has, but USD is performing better than other fiat such as with IDR (my country's currency) which is weakening with the dollar, lucky for those who always keep the dollar so that it can be an additional fund to prepare for the recession prediction which is believed to peak next year.
And one of the reasons why the dollar is performing better and can even survive in these difficult conditions is because countries will use the dollar when paying their debts and transactions in the world are dominated by the dollar.
